Accurate Peak Measurements provide invaluable information for the layperson or technician who needs to assess potential biological impacts at an RF contaminated site. The HFE35C equipped with the Isotropic Antenna takes biological assessment one step further. Referred to as 3D Measurement Technology the Ultra Broadband Isotopic Antenna has the ability to assimilate and read the RF exposure conditions typical for a human body. A measurement taken with this equipment provides a 360 degree RF exposure snap shot. Comes Equipped with Two Antennas: The HFE35C analyzer has enhanced circuitry for use with the Ultra Broadband Isotropic UBB27 Antenna – Boosted Frequency Range of 27 MHz– 3.3GHz The directional Logarithmic– Periodic Antenna is designed to make source identification simple and efficient. Readings increase when the antenna is pointed in the direction of or moved closer to offending sources – Frequency Range of 800MHz to 2.5 GHz Plus Professional Level Features Offered at a Unique Price to Performance Ratio: Audio Analysis: The meter's audio tone replicates the patterns and intensity of measured RF emissions Detects Full RF Signal Full RF signal is comprised of both analogue and pulsed digital signals. Coarse (0–1999 W/m) and Fine (0–199.9 W/m) Range Options: A Fine range option provides added value when needing accurate assessment of weaker signals. Peak Value + Average Measurement Settings: While measurements taken on the Average Value setting provide a general impression of RF levels at a test site, the Peak Value setting reveals the highest levels of RF being emitted. The Peak Value is regarded as the measurement critical to assessing potential biological effects.
